May 22, 2019 May 22, 2019 Rake thickener can be divided into central driving thickener and peripheral transmission thickener according to the transmission mode, and it is one of the common thickening equipment used in the thickening and dehydration operation of mineral processing plant. Rake thickener has large processing capacity, wide range of feeding concentration, higher concentration of concentrated product

In the beneficiation plant, the thickener is widely used in the thickening of pulp and tailings, so that the backwater can be recycled and the concentrate is dewatered before filtering. Thickeners can be widely used in the treatment of sludge, wastewater, and waste residues
Jan 24, 2020 Thickener is the common mineral processing equipment in mineral processing plant, which is widely used in the concentration and dewatering of mineral processing plant.However, in the practical operation, the fault rate of thickener is up to 37%. Therefore, daily maintenance is vital . The daily maintenance includes the daily check, machine lubrication, preventive maintenance and other maintenance

Mineral beneficiation is the process of concentration, and was first described in Agricola's famous treatise, De Re Metallica, published in 1556. The earliest ores to be discovered and processed were of such high grade that they did not require beneficiation, and they satisfied mankind's needs for nearly 3,000 years
